Tried relocating within Lagos. An agent promised me a 2-bedroom in Ogudu for ₦800k. I spent over ₦150k on hotels + transport for inspections… only to be told the place had been given to someone else. After 3 weeks and about ₦200k burned, I gave up and moved to Ibadan.
Ibadan was calmer… until the “24-hour solar” in my apartment turned out to be a lie. Constant blackouts, heat, stress. Started house hunting again.
That’s when I realized the “Ibadan is cheap” story is mostly marketing. Agents misleading, inspection fees everywhere, some landlords straight up refusing single tenants. After 2 months and tripling my budget, I finally found a decent place in Onireke GRA.
House hunting here isn’t just stressful, it’s a full-time psychological test.
